Scheduled Technical Maintenance

We provide recurring maintenance attendance for motor yachts requiring dependable, structured care throughout the season and during quieter periods. Service can include machinery observation, fluid and filter review, system testing, equipment inspection, battery support, and pre-departure readiness checks. By establishing a recurring technical rhythm, we help reduce downtime, support safer operation, and ensure the yacht remains consistently prepared instead of being serviced only after faults emerge.

Onboard Diagnostics and Fault Tracing

When irregular sounds, warning behaviors, power inconsistencies, or performance concerns appear, we carry out diagnostic assessment to identify likely causes and recommend the right corrective path. Our approach prioritizes methodical inspection and practical interpretation, helping owners and crews understand whether an issue requires immediate repair, monitored follow-up, or broader system attention. This reduces guesswork and limits unnecessary intervention.

Seasonal Commissioning and Lay-Up Support

Transition points in the yachting calendar often determine how smoothly the rest of the season unfolds. We assist with recommissioning after inactivity, startup reviews, operational checks, and post-season lay-up support designed to preserve systems and reduce reactivation issues later. This attention to seasonal changeover improves long-term condition and gives owners greater confidence when usage resumes.
